description
The Commissioners view this as a strategically important service that supports numerous key initiatives relating to improved community-based care for people in Surrey, and as such linked to common outcomes for both the health and social care sectors.
They are, therefore, seeking an experienced, competent and innovative provider who will work with them as a strategic business partner in a collaborative spirit of openness and trust and who will pro-actively support them in developing service initiatives that will deliver quality and value for the people of Surrey. The service provider will provide evidence of quality assured policies and procedures that will be applied to this service.
In general, this will be achieved by the service provider being able to effectively source, store, deliver, fit, demonstrate, maintain, collect, clean, refurbish and offer technical advice on equipment, as well as to install and where necessary, construct, adaptations.
The commissioners will expect and encourage a successful provider to use their experience and knowledge to make submissions that may innovate and expand on what is defined within the specification in order to promote and deliver a more effective service. Any proposals may be included within the content of the various associated as part of their general submission and/or with reference to the Tender Questions, but they must be clearly defined and expressed. There is an expectation that, where agreed, these proposals will be incorporated and adhered to as part of the contract with the successful service provider.
This is a statutory service requirement and SCC will be leading the commissioning and procurement on behalf of the 6 (7) Clinical Commissioning Groups (CCG’s) and can therefore call off from this contract. They're as follows:
- East Surrey,
- Guildford and Waverley,
- North East Hampshire and Farnham,
- North West Surrey,
- Surrey Downs,
- Surrey Heath,
- (Windsor, Ascot and Maidenhead).
This is a 3 year contract with the option to extend for a further 2 1-year periods.
